Upon further review and after a lengthy consultation with my colleagues on press row, I want to revisit one paragraph from an earlier blog entry. I’m massaging it like a sore hamstring.
I wrote earlier that the Orioles have 30 players in camp. Correct. That total will go down to 27 once infielder Brendan Harris is reassigned, Britton is optioned and starter Justin Duchscherer is placed on the disabled list. Also correct.
However, the number shrinks to 26 once Rick VandenHurk officially comes off the roster. It hasn’t happened, though he’s no longer here. It’s just a matter of time. I wasn’t including him in the original 30.
Brad Bergesen, Chris Tillman, Robert Andino and Craig Tatum appear to be the four players vying for three spots. Tillman could start on April 3 while Bergesen goes to the bullpen. Bergesen could start April 3 while Tillman goes to the minors and the Orioles carry three catchers, including Jake Fox.
